Why Kawasaki FX850V Oil Filter Is Necessary

I use an oil filter on my Kawasaki FX850V because it helps keep the engine oil clean. As the engine runs, dirt, metal particles, and other tiny debris can build up in the oil. If I let those contaminants circulate, they can wear down important engine parts faster and shorten the life of the engine.

My oil filter also helps my engine stay protected under heavy use. The FX850V is built for demanding work, and when I’m mowing or running the engine for long periods, clean oil matters even more. A good filter keeps the oil flowing properly while trapping harmful particles before they cause damage.

I also see the oil filter as a simple way to help my engine run smoother and more reliably. When the oil stays cleaner, my engine can maintain better lubrication, reduce friction, and avoid unnecessary overheating. For me, replacing the oil filter regularly is an easy step that helps protect my investment and keeps my Kawasaki FX850V performing well.

My Buying Guides on Kawasaki Fx850v Oil Filter

When I started looking for a Kawasaki FX850V oil filter, I quickly realized that not every filter is the same. Even if a filter claims to fit, I always check the details carefully because the wrong choice can affect engine performance and long-term reliability. Here’s how I approach buying one.

1. I Check Compatibility First

The first thing I do is confirm that the oil filter is made for the Kawasaki FX850V engine. I never rely only on a general “fits Kawasaki” label. I compare the part number, engine model, and application list to make sure it matches my mower or equipment exactly.

2. I Look at OEM vs. Aftermarket Options

I usually decide whether I want an OEM Kawasaki filter or a trusted aftermarket option. OEM filters give me peace of mind because they are designed specifically for the engine. Aftermarket filters can be a good value, but I only choose brands with strong reviews and proven quality.

3. I Check Filtration Quality

For me, filtration quality matters a lot. I want a filter that can trap fine particles without restricting oil flow. A well-made filter helps protect the engine from wear, especially if I use the machine often or in dusty conditions.

4. I Pay Attention to Build Quality

I always inspect the filter construction. I look for a sturdy metal canister, a strong gasket, and solid sealing materials. If the filter feels cheap or poorly made, I skip it because I do not want leaks or premature failure.
